Here it is again worth noting Acharya Bhattar's opinion on chanting (japam). He says niyama viSEshavan mantrAdi Avartnam is japam or repeating mantras etc. with some principles attached. A brahmin is still considered a brahmin if he does japam (chanting), whether he does other karmas or not, says Bhattar quoting from Manusmrti. What one has to chant? stuvan nAma sahasrENa - clarifies Bhattar, thousands of names of the Lord which glorify His qualities. Then why ashtAksharI japam is not prescribed in Ramanuja sampradayam? One may get a doubt. It is a single mantra and meaning is available. So it is convenient to concentrate on the meaning. In case of stOtras like vishNu sahasranAma, somebody has to be an Eisnstein to understand and chant simultaneously.
